如何给需求定优先级

如何给需求定优先级

给需求定优先级的方式包括:了解业务价值、评估实现难度、考虑用户需求、分析市场竞争、综合团队资源。 其中,了解业务价值是确定需求优先级的重要因素之一。业务价值指的是某个需求的实现能为公司带来的效益,包括直接的经济收益和间接的品牌影响等。通过评估每个需求的业务价值,可以帮助团队专注于那些对公司发展最有帮助的功能和改进,从而更好地利用资源,提升产品的市场竞争力和用户满意度。

一、了解业务价值

了解业务价值是需求优先级评定中最关键的一步。需求的业务价值可以通过以下几个方面来评估:

  1. 直接经济效益:需求的实现能否直接带来收入增长或成本节约。例如,一个新功能能否吸引更多用户付费使用,或者某项优化能否减少运营成本。
  2. 用户满意度:需求的实现是否能显著提升用户体验和满意度。例如,用户反馈中频繁提到的问题得到解决,可能会大大增加用户的忠诚度和推荐意愿。
  3. 市场竞争力:需求的实现能否增强产品的市场竞争力。例如,增加某些功能能否使产品在市场上更具竞争优势,从而吸引更多用户。
  4. 战略意义:需求的实现是否符合公司的长期战略目标。例如,某些需求可能是为了进入新市场或实现产品多样化,这些需求虽然短期内没有明显收益,但对公司长期发展至关重要。

二、评估实现难度

评估实现难度是给需求定优先级的另一个重要方面。实现难度可以通过以下几个维度来考量:

  1. 技术难度:需求的实现需要多大的技术投入和技术挑战。例如,某些需求可能需要新的技术开发,或者需要克服现有技术框架的限制。
  2. 资源投入:需求的实现需要多少人力、时间和其他资源。例如,某些需求可能需要跨部门合作,或者需要大量的开发和测试资源。
  3. 风险评估:需求的实现过程中可能遇到的风险和不确定性。例如,某些需求可能涉及较大的技术风险或者市场风险,需要提前做好风险评估和应对措施。

三、考虑用户需求

用户需求是需求优先级评定中的核心因素之一。通过用户调研和数据分析,可以了解用户最迫切的需求和痛点,从而确定需求的优先级:

  1. 用户调研:通过问卷调查、用户访谈等方式,直接获取用户的需求和反馈。例如,可以通过定期的用户调研,了解用户对现有功能的满意度和对新功能的期望。
  2. 数据分析:通过数据分析工具,了解用户的行为和使用习惯。例如,可以通过分析用户的点击和使用数据,了解哪些功能最受欢迎,哪些功能使用频率较低,从而确定需求的优先级。
  3. 用户反馈:通过用户反馈渠道,了解用户的意见和建议。例如,可以通过用户反馈平台、社交媒体等渠道,收集用户的意见和建议,从而了解用户的真实需求。

四、分析市场竞争

分析市场竞争情况,可以帮助团队了解竞争对手的动态和市场趋势,从而确定需求的优先级:

  1. 竞争对手分析:通过分析竞争对手的产品功能和市场策略,了解他们的优势和劣势。例如,可以通过竞争对手的产品更新日志和市场活动,了解他们的新功能和市场策略,从而确定自己的需求优先级。
  2. 市场趋势分析:通过分析市场趋势,了解行业的发展方向和用户的需求变化。例如,可以通过市场研究报告和行业分析,了解市场的最新动态和用户的需求变化,从而确定需求的优先级。
  3. 用户需求变化:通过分析用户需求的变化,了解用户的最新需求和痛点。例如,可以通过用户调研和数据分析,了解用户需求的变化,从而确定需求的优先级。

五、综合团队资源

综合团队资源是确定需求优先级的一个重要因素。通过评估团队的资源和能力,可以确定哪些需求可以优先实现:

  1. 团队能力评估:通过评估团队的技术能力和经验,确定哪些需求可以优先实现。例如,某些需求可能需要特定的技术能力和经验,可以优先考虑实现这些需求。
  2. 资源配置评估:通过评估团队的资源配置和工作负荷,确定哪些需求可以优先实现。例如,某些需求可能需要较多的资源和时间,可以优先考虑实现这些需求。
  3. 项目管理工具:通过使用项目管理工具,可以更好地管理团队的资源和工作负荷,从而确定需求的优先级。例如,PingCode和Worktile是两款非常优秀的项目管理工具,可以帮助团队更好地管理需求和资源,从而确定需求的优先级。【PingCode官网】、【Worktile官网

六、总结

给需求定优先级是一个复杂而重要的过程,需要综合考虑业务价值、实现难度、用户需求、市场竞争和团队资源等多个因素。在实际操作中,可以通过以下几个步骤来确定需求的优先级:

  1. 业务价值评估:通过评估需求的业务价值,确定哪些需求对公司发展最有帮助。
  2. 实现难度评估:通过评估需求的实现难度,确定哪些需求可以优先实现。
  3. 用户需求分析:通过用户调研和数据分析,了解用户的真实需求和痛点,确定需求的优先级。
  4. 市场竞争分析:通过分析市场竞争情况,了解竞争对手的动态和市场趋势,确定需求的优先级。
  5. 团队资源评估:通过评估团队的资源和能力,确定哪些需求可以优先实现。

通过以上步骤,可以帮助团队更好地确定需求的优先级,从而提高产品的市场竞争力和用户满意度。同时,可以通过使用项目管理工具,如PingCode和Worktile,更好地管理需求和资源,从而提高团队的工作效率和项目管理能力。【PingCode官网】、【Worktile官网】

相关问答FAQs:

1. 为什么需要给需求定优先级?
给需求定优先级可以帮助团队更好地管理项目,确保资源的有效分配和任务的有序完成。

2. 如何确定需求的优先级?
需求的优先级可以根据以下几个因素来确定:

  • 价值和影响力: 评估需求对项目成功的重要性和对用户价值的影响。
  • 紧急程度: 判断需求是否有紧迫的截止日期或关键时间点。
  • 成本和资源限制: 考虑实施需求所需的资源、时间和成本。
  • 风险和复杂性: 评估需求实现过程中可能出现的风险和复杂性。

3. 如何管理需求的优先级?
管理需求的优先级可以采取以下步骤:

  • 收集和整理需求: 确保所有需求都被记录下来,然后进行分类和整理。
  • 评估和排序需求: 根据上述因素评估每个需求,并将其排序为高、中、低优先级。
  • 制定优先级计划: 基于需求的优先级,制定一个计划,确保高优先级需求在前期得到满足。
  • 持续跟踪和调整: 随着项目的进展,需求的优先级可能会发生变化,因此需要持续跟踪和调整优先级计划。

文章标题:如何给需求定优先级,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3720746

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部